The latest iteration from Avid - Pro Tools HDX was released in October of 2011, the HDX PCIe cards empowered Pro Tools users to run loads of DSP powered plugins, up to 192 IO channels, and up to 768 voices, which enabled professional audio users the ability to do pretty much anything they could imagine in pro audio.īut a decade is a long time in modern technology and what people can imagine doing has evolved significantly since 2011. However as we have all found, as CPUs have become faster and more powerful and the amount of RAM available has increased, more and more of the audio processing can be handled on the computer’s own processors, rather than shipping it off to dedicated processors."

To get a full 64 channels of I/O, the Pro Tools | HDX PCIe card allows you to connect up to four, 16-channel Pro Tools | HD audio interfaces.

The card easily installs into your existing Mac or Windows tower/desktop computer. It provides up to 256 voiceable tracks, 64 channels of simultaneous I/O, and supports up to 24-bit / 192 kHz Pro Tools sessions. The Avid Pro Tools | HDX PCIe Card brings high-speed DSP power to your Pro Tools | HDX system for direct-to-disk recording and playback, and plug-in processing with near-zero latency.
